RFS Technologies RADIAFLEX® RF Feeder Cable

RFS Technologies RADIAFLEX® RF Feeder Cable

RADIAFLEX® radiating cables are “leaky feeder” coaxial cables designed to provide continuous RF coverage along the length of the cable. Instead of feeding a single antenna, the cable radiates signals through slots in the outer conductor, acting as a distributed antenna system (DAS) for tunnels, underground spaces, and large buildings.

 

Key Benefits

  • Continuous RF coverage along the entire cable length
  • Eliminates need for multiple antennas in confined spaces
  • Supports multi-band wireless systems (2G, 3G, 4G, 5G and mission-critical radio)
  • Reliable communication in challenging environments like tunnels and underground infrastructure
  • Low signal loss and high durability for long deployments

Typical Specifications

Parameter Typical Value
Characteristic Impedance 50 Ω
Dielectric Foam polyethylene
Outer Conductor Corrugated copper with radiating slots
Transmission Mode Distributed radiating antenna
Signal Type One-way and two-way communication
PIM Performance Low PIM designs available
Jacket Options Flame-retardant, halogen-free, plenum rated

These cables are designed to support multiple communication services simultaneously due to broadband capability.

 

Available Cable Sizes

Typical RADIAFLEX cable diameters:

Cable Size Typical Application
1/2″ Small tunnels, parking garages, buildings
7/8″ Medium tunnels and underground systems
1-1/4″ Long tunnels, railways, large infrastructure
1-5/8″ Very long tunnels or high-power systems

Larger cables provide longer coverage distance and lower loss.

 

Frequency Range

Typical supported frequencies:

Range Example Services
75 MHz – 450 MHz Public safety radio
600 – 960 MHz Cellular & mission-critical
1700 – 2700 MHz LTE
3400 – 4200 MHz 5G / CBRS / C-Band
Up to ~6 GHz Future wireless services

RADIAFLEX cables support all commercial and mission-critical services up to around 6 GHz.

 

Transmission Line Type

  • Radiating coaxial transmission line (Leaky feeder cable)
  • Corrugated outer conductor with precision slots to radiate RF energy
  • Foam dielectric insulation
  • 50-ohm impedance

Unlike standard coax cables, these function as a distributed antenna along the cable length.

 

Common Connector Types

Typical connectors used with RADIAFLEX systems:

  • N-type connectors
  • 7/16 DIN connectors
  • 4.3-10 connectors
  • EIA flange connectors (for large cables)

Connector families are designed to minimize PIM and maintain RF performance.

 

Typical Applications

RADIAFLEX cables are widely used in:

  • Metro and railway tunnels
  • Road tunnels
  • Mines
  • Underground stations
  • Airports and large buildings
  • Public safety communication systems

RADIAFLEX cables provide reliable connectivity in confined areas where traditional antennas cannot deliver consistent coverage.

 

FLEXWELL® Premium Elliptical Waveguide

RFS Technologies FLEXWELL® elliptical waveguide is constructed of longitudinally continuous seam welded, highly conductive copper tube, corrugated and precision formed into an elliptical cross section.
